Airport guide

Reagan National is the most convenient airport for DC proper, but it is also one of the most regulated for private aviation in the country. All general aviation operations require compliance with the DCA Access Standard Security Program (DASSP), which mandates TSA-approved security procedures, passenger and crew screening, and an armed security officer on every flight. These requirements apply to all Part 135 charter operators. Plan ahead: the logistics take more coordination than a typical private departure.

The airport operates under the FAA High Density Rule, making it a slot-controlled facility. Slots for general aviation are limited and must be secured in advance. Last-minute departures here are harder to arrange than at Dulles or BWI. If your schedule is flexible, operators often recommend those alternatives for easier logistics and lower costs.

The FBO is Signature Flight Support, located on the south side of the field. The terminal is compact and efficient. For passengers who clear the DASSP requirements and secure a slot, the proximity to DC makes the extra coordination worthwhile.

Getting there

Downtown DC is 4 to 6 miles from the terminal depending on your destination. The White House is about 4 miles, Capitol Hill about 5 miles, Georgetown about 4 miles. Drive times in normal traffic run 15 to 25 minutes. During rush hour on the 14th Street Bridge corridor, expect 30 to 45 minutes. The airport has a dedicated Metro station on the Blue and Yellow lines, with direct service to downtown DC in about 15 to 20 minutes. Car services and rideshare both operate from the terminal. For passengers connecting to northern Virginia or the Pentagon area, Reagan National is the obvious choice over Dulles.
